If your air conditioning equipment includes F gases then you’re probably aware of the importance of getting it checked regularly by certified F Gas professionals. There are complex regulations around using this type of equipment and it must be handled delicately accordingly to strict guidelines.

Fortunately, it is easy for a business or private customer to check up on F gas compliance. For example, K2 are registered with REFCOM, the industry-leading F gas compliance registrar. Simply visit www.refcom.org, enter K2 in the 'Company Name' field and click 'Go.' You should see us listed in the results that come up. Alternatively, you can type in our reference number (REF1009232).
